A number of punches were used to create my little Koala.  I had fun playing around getting his shape right.

1 3/4″ circle, 1 3/8″ circle, 1 1/4″ circle, 1″ circle, Extra-Large Oval, Large Oval, 2 step Bird Punch, 2 step Owl Punch, Boho Blossoms, Itty Bitty Shapes pack, Word Window Punch. His kerchief was made with a 2cmx2cm square of red card.  I also added some sponging and a little Dazzling Diamonds with 2 way glue pen and used white gel pen for his eyes and black marker for his mouth.  I think that about covers it.  He is very cute.

For the rest of the card, the greeting is from ‘Wishing You’ and I cut the edge of the Gumball Green card with the zig-zag edge from the Finishing Touches Edgelits.  Just a little strip of Gumball Green Satin Stitched Ribbon finishes it off.

I have used the stamp set ‘Tag-it”.  Did you know that Stampin’ Up! will donate $3 from the sale of this stamp set to Ronald McDonald House Charities.  Isn’t that great!  I stamped it first in Island Indigo and then with Versamark and embossed it in silver.  Then cut the trophy out and adhered it on to the stamped image.  I added a small Rhinestone in the middle.  I think it is still OK to have bling on a boys card, don’t you think??

Once this was done it was all  layered on a Silver Glimmer circle punched with the 2 1/2″ circle punch.  I embossed a strip of Pool Party card with the ‘Alphabet Press’ Embossing Folder and layered a strip of silver glimmer paper underneath. I stamped the base card with ‘Gorgeous Grunge’ before assembling it all together.

I embossed the card with the Stylish Stripes Embossing Folder.  The Santa is from ‘Santa’s List’  He is simply stamped in Cherry Cobbler and I used 2 way Glue pen to apply the Dazzling Diamonds around his beard, cuffs and hat.  It does sparkle so nicely in real life.  The circles were cut with the Circles Framelits.  I used a little strip of ‘Season of Style’ DSP.  There really is not much more you need to do.
